Meaning
to lack something, fail to find it, or lose one's way or self-control.
Good to know
A very common verb; also used idiomatically for losing one's temper or being at a loss.
Examples
- Turabura amazi muri iki gihe c'ubukame.We lack water during this dry season.
- Ni kubera iki wabuze inzira?Why did you lose your way?
- Ntabura ijambo ryo kuvuga.He is never at a loss for words.
- Ejo tuzobura amahoro tudafashe ingingo.Tomorrow we will lack peace if we don't make a decision.
